Size
When choosing the right chest freezer, size is a crucial factor to consider. You'll need to think about the amount of storage space you'll need and what type of foods you'll store in it. As a general rule, you should allow 2.5 cubic feet per person to your cheap fridge freezer. However, this may differ based on the amount of food you keep. If you have extra meat or produce to store, for example you might require a bigger freezer.
Chest freezers can be classified as medium, small or large. A small chest freezer can hold between 3.5 and 7 cubic feet of food. While medium-sized chest freezers holds between 7.1 to 14 cubic feet. Large cheap fridge Freezers uk are fridge best price for households that need to store large amounts of food items. They have a storage capacity between 14 and 25 cubic feet.
